1. Go Bold with Dark Green Walls

Living room with deep green walls and brass mirror

Painting your walls dark green instantly elevates the ambiance of your living room, giving it a moody, sophisticated vibe. Whether you opt for a deep forest green, olive, or emerald, this color can act as a rich backdrop that complements everything from vintage furniture to modern decor.

Tips for Green Walls:

  • Matte Finishes: Choose matte or eggshell finishes for a soft, velvety look that doesn’t overwhelm.
  • Accent Wall: If you’re hesitant to paint all four walls, consider a single accent wall paired with neutral tones like cream or taupe on the others.
  • Pair with Gold or Brass: Metallic accents like brass sconces or gold-framed mirrors add elegance and contrast.

Dark green walls work particularly well in rooms that get ample natural light, which enhances the depth and richness of the shade without making the room feel too enclosed.

2. Add a Dark Green Sofa as a Statement Piece

Dark green velvet sofa with light walls and cozy decor

A dark green sofa is a bold, elegant choice that instantly anchors your living room. Whether it’s velvet, leather, or a soft linen, the richness of the color adds visual interest and a touch of luxury.

Styling Ideas:

  • Contrast with Light Walls: A green sofa against white or light beige walls creates a fresh, airy balance.
  • Throw Pillows & Textures: Accent with neutral-toned or earth-toned throw pillows. You can also layer with different textures — like wool, knit, or leather — for dimension.
  • Surround with Neutrals: To let the sofa shine, keep surrounding furniture in wood, white, or beige tones.

If you’re designing a minimalist space, the green sofa can serve as the focal point while maintaining a clean aesthetic.

3. Use Botanical Prints and Green Accents

Botanical-themed living room with green accents and prints

One of the most natural ways to incorporate dark green into your living room is through accessories and patterns. Botanical prints — whether in framed wall art, wallpaper, or upholstery — can enhance the color story without overpowering the space.

How to Incorporate Green Accents:

  • Cushions and Curtains: Try dark green curtains or leafy cushion covers to subtly tie the theme together.
  • Decor Accessories: Vases, trays, or candle holders in green-glazed ceramics can provide rich, earthy texture.
  • Wallpaper: Tropical or abstract green wallpapers work well on one wall or in alcoves to create interest.

Using botanical prints bridges the line between modern and organic, helping your living room feel grounded and inviting.

4. Incorporate Natural Wood and Earthy Tones

Living room with green walls and natural wood elements

Dark green pairs beautifully with warm wood tones like walnut, oak, and teak. Bringing in wooden elements can create a cozy, nature-inspired atmosphere that complements the lushness of green.

Suggestions for Earthy Styling:

  • Coffee Table or Sideboards: Choose wooden furniture with clean lines to create harmony with the green elements.
  • Layer with Earthy Colors: Rust, mustard, clay, and beige tones all blend beautifully with dark green and add warmth.
  • Rattan or Woven Pieces: Consider a rattan chair or jute rug to introduce texture and balance.

Wood elements soften the boldness of dark green and help your space feel organic and timeless.

5. Layer Green with Other Jewel Tones

Dark green sofa with jewel-tone pillows and abstract art

For a richer, more dramatic design approach, consider pairing dark green with other jewel tones like navy blue, burgundy, or deep purple. These colors complement each other beautifully and can make your living room feel like a luxurious escape.

Color Pairing Ideas:

  • Cushions and Throws: Mix in velvet throws or jewel-toned pillows for a layered, high-end look.
  • Wall Art: Abstract prints or textured artwork in multiple rich tones can bring visual balance.
  • Accent Chairs: Try adding an armchair in a contrasting jewel tone to make the space pop.

This approach is perfect for those who love bold interiors and want their living room to exude personality and richness.

6. Add Dark Green Through Rugs and Upholstery

Living room with green rug details and upholstered accents

If painting your walls or investing in a green sofa feels like too much commitment, you can still enjoy the beauty of dark green by incorporating it through textiles and upholstery.

Subtle Integration Ideas:

  • Area Rugs: A Persian or geometric rug with dark green detailing can ground the space and add pattern.
  • Upholstered Ottomans or Chairs: Opt for an accent chair or ottoman in dark green to introduce the color subtly.
  • Green in Layers: Use layers of green in varying shades across different elements — think olive throw pillows, forest green ottoman, and a muted green rug.

This approach works well in both minimalist and eclectic living rooms and lets you update your color scheme seasonally or gradually.

7. Mix in Modern Lighting and Metallics

Dark green room with brass lighting and gold decor

Dark green benefits from the right lighting — especially when combined with metallic tones like gold, brass, or even matte black. These accents help reflect light and enhance the richness of green.

Lighting Ideas to Elevate the Space:

  • Statement Pendant Lights: Consider a gold-accented chandelier or globe pendant for a luxurious touch.
  • Wall Sconces: Brass wall lights above art or mirrors bring elegance and function.
  • Table Lamps: Look for lamps with emerald green bases, mixed metal finishes, or glass details to tie everything together.

Good lighting doesn’t just brighten a dark green room — it also highlights its depth and sophistication, creating a truly welcoming atmosphere.
